Senior Tax Associate – Public Accounting
A respected and growing public accounting firm in Chicago, IL, is se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Senior Tax Associate to join its tax practice. This is a full-time, hybrid role that offers exposure to a broad range of clients and tax scenarios in both Federal and State & Local Tax (SALT) areas.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are individual, partnership, corporate, and fiduciary tax returns.
  • Assist with documentation and client file maintenance procedures.
  • Research and analyze federal and state tax matters to ensure compliance.
  • Contribute to tax planning strategies and provide required analysis.
  • Draft responses to tax notices, audits, and related matters from federal and state agencies.
  • Support the tax team with ongoing client engagements and project management.
  • Collaborate with other departments, including wealth management professionals, to deliver integrated client solutions.
  • Stay current with changes in tax laws through continuing education.
  • Review your work for accuracy and quality.
  • Apply feedback for personal development and growth.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or related field.
  • 2–4 years of public accounting or equivalent tax experience.
  • CPA, JD, or EA preferred (or actively pursuing).
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ite; experience with QuickBooks and tax preparation software (e.g., UltraTax) is a plus.
  • Strong communication and organizational skills.
  • Capable of manag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Demonstrated problem-solving skills and ability to work both independently and as part of a team.

Work Schedule

  • Generally, 40–45 hours/week outside of the busy season.
  • Heavier workloads during tax season.

Work Environment

  • Hybrid schedule with in-office presence expected at least 3 days per week.
  • Office is conveniently located near public transportation in northwest Chicago.

Compensation & Benefits

  • Competitive compensation package.
  • Excellent health benefits, including employer-paid major medical coverage, for employees.
  • 401(k) with company match.
  • Unlimited PTO, sick time, and office closure between Christmas and New Year’s.
